fuel line, pressure side

I'm converting an 81 El Camino. Factory conventional fuel delivery for NA carbed V6 (no fuel return return). I'm reusing that supply line as the new return line, but now I need to add a new fuel line. Braided satinless and A/N fittings look cool and all, but isn't there a better way? The original hanger I salvaged just had 2 hose clamps on it into a rubber hose. Safe or not?

fuel line

I would just use steel break line. Thats what I used on mine 3/8 all the way back. Just use hp injector hose between the pump and line etc. They also have coated ones too. I used the raw ones and started to rust a little so if you go that way I would paint it after the install. Hope that helps
